Secure element technology is a hardware-based security feature that provides a secure environment for storing sensitive data such as payment information and encryption keys. It often involves a tamper-resistant integrated circuit that can securely store and process data in a protected manner, helping to prevent unauthorized access or tampering with the stored information. Secure element technology is commonly used in devices like smart cards, SIM cards, and secure chips embedded in various devices to enhance security and protect sensitive data.
